Acceptance Rate and Application Statistics

The following table compares the admission related statistics including number of applicants, admitted, and enrolled between selected colleges. The average acceptance rate of selected colleges is 48.58% and the average admission yield (enrollment rate) is 23.70%.
Carleton College has the tighest (lowest) acceptance rate of 16.63% and Carleton College has the highest yield (enrollment rate) of 37.28% among selected colleges. The numbers in parenthesis() in below table represent the number and rate by gender (men/women). The stat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023.
Admission Stats Comparison Between Selected Colleges
Name ApplicantsAdmittedEnrolledAcceptance RateEnrollment Rate
Augsburg University 3,423 (1,412/2,009) 2,619 (998/1,619) 612 (258/352) 77% (71%/81%) 23% (26%/18%)
Carleton College 8,583 (4,092/4,491) 1,427 (679/748) 532 (268/264) 17% (17%/17%) 37% (39%/6%)
Macalester College 8,434 (3,455/4,979) 2,397 (911/1,486) 552 (213/339) 28% (26%/30%) 23% (23%/7%)
The College of Saint Scholastica 1,653 (597/1,049) 1,597 (563/1,027) 367 (141/225) 97% (94%/98%) 23% (25%/21%)
University of St Thomas 9,481 (4,501/4,980) 7,300 (3,369/3,931) 1,573 (791/782) 77% (75%/79%) 22% (23%/16%)
Mitchell Hamline School of Law No admission statistics available for the school.
Average6,315 (2,811/2,811)3,068 (1,304/1,762)727 (334/392)48.58% (46.4%/62.7%)23.70% (25.6%/22.3%)
